Abstract

In embodiments, a modular rifle includes a lower receiver assembly, an upper receiver assembly housing a barrel, and a coupling mechanism. Upper receiver assembly has two portions, an aft portion and fore portion, commonly comprising a hand guard. The barrel is releasably attached to the upper receiver first portion by a hand-tightenable barrel nut sleeve connector. Upper receiver second portion is both releasably attached to the barrel nut connector sleeve and to the upper receiver first portion to prevent the barrel nut connector sleeve from rotating during firing of the rifle and to keep the second portion from detaching during firing of the rifle. Attachment of upper receiver second portion to the barrel nut connector sleeve is accomplished by a removable take-down pin and common screw clamp, which secure the barrel nut connector sleeve. Upper receiver first and second portions are connected by an attachment tab and receptacle.

Claims (39)

1. A modular rifle system comprising:

a lower receiver assembly;

an upper receiver assembly; and

a barrel assembly;

wherein the barrel assembly is releasably attached to a first portion of the upper receiver assembly by a barrel nut connector sleeve capable of being tightened by hand, the connector sleeve is prevented from becoming untightened and unconnected during firing of the rifle system by a second portion of the upper receiver assembly, and the second portion of the upper receiver assembly is releasably attached to the barrel assembly and the first portion of the upper receiver assembly,

wherein the second portion of the upper receiver assembly is releasably attached to the barrel nut connector sleeve by means of a take-down pin inserted through the second portion of the upper receiver assembly and engaging is receptacle groove in the barrel nut connector sleeve; and

wherein the second portion of the upper receiver assembly is releasably coupled to the first portion of the upper receiver assembly by means of an alignment tab and an alignment tab receptacle, wherein the second portion of the upper receiver is prevented from rotating during firing of the rifle system by coupling of the alignment tab and alignment tab receptacle.

8. A method of assembling and disassembling a barrel of a modular rifle system having an upper receiver assembly and a removable barrel assembly, comprising the steps of:

aligning the barrel assembly with a first portion of the upper receiver;

releasably affixing the barrel assembly to the first portion of the upper receiver assembly;

releasably securing affixment of the barrel assembly by means of a hand-tightenable barrel nut connector sleeve;

aligning a second portion of the upper receiver assembly with the first portion of the upper receiver assembly;

releasably connecting the first and the second portion of the upper receiver assembly;

releasably attaching the second portion of the upper receiver assembly to the barrel nut connector sleeve, wherein the second portion of the upper receiver assembly secures the barrel nut connector sleeve from rotating and the second portion of the upper receiver assembly from becoming detached during firing of the rifle system,

wherein the barrel assembly is releasably secured to the first portion of the upper receiver assembly by threading the barrel nut connector sleeve onto a threaded nipple on the forward face of the first portion of the upper receiver assembly and tightened by hand to secure the barrel assembly to the first portion of the upper receiver assembly;

wherein the second portion of the upper receiver assembly is releasably coupled to the first portion of the upper receiver assembly by aligning and inserting an alignment tab on one portion of the upper receiver assembly into an alignment tab receptacle on the other portion of the upper receiver assembly, wherein the second portion of the upper receiver is prevented from rotating during firing of the rifle system by coupling of the alignment tab and the alignment tab receptacle; and

wherein attaching the second portion of the upper receiver to the barrel nut connector sleeve is accomplished by inserting a removable pin through the second portion of the upper receiver assembly, in which the pin engages a receptacle groove integrated into the outer diameter of the barrel nut connector sleeve.
